    Q. How can students learn the value of design?

    Report

    small-ideaplay1.jpg

    A. Using Ideaplay, an idea generation kit for students, developed by design consultancy Engine and The Design Council.

    Ideaplay is an interactive workshop which is easily integrated into any enterprise course and is adaptable for any age, level or specific subject area. It trains budding entrepreneurs to observe everyday situations, find problems and solutions, assess their ideas collectively, and it builds team working skills. Continue Reading »
